Roald Dahl, one of the most famous authors, and his supremely famous “Charlie and The Chocolate Factory” is one such book that has seen a lot of transformations. The book has been adapted several times in the form of movies and musicals. Now, this is again getting another adaptation in the form of “Wonka”. “Wonka” is supposed to be a tad bit different and from what buzz is around, it already looks super interesting.
“Wonka” had already announced its lead star. Timothée Chalamet will be essaying the lead role of Willy Wonka and now there’s one more addition to the film. Actor Keegan-Michael Key is the latest addition to the film. His role as of now is completely under the wraps, and given the type of movie “Wonka” will be, it is even hard to guess. Wonka will be a movie that will focus more on the famous chocolatier’s life. It will focus on his childhood, his influences, and what led him to become the owner of the mad and amazing Chocolate Factory.
Since the movie is set before the events of Charlie winning the Golden Ticket and getting to visit the Chocolate Factory, we won’t be seeing the young kids in the movie. Wonka will be directed by Paul King who is known for “Paddington” and its sequel. Harry Potter’s producer David Heyman will be producing the film. King has also written the screenplay of the movie with Simon Farnaby. Luke Kelly and Alexandra Derbyshire will also serve as producers while Michael Siegel will executive produce “Wonka”. The movie is set to begin its production in September this year. Wonka is set to release in theatres on March 17, 2023, and will be distributed by Warner Bros.
